Detailed Comparison

When comparing Amarillo, TX and Birmingham, AL, the overall cost of living indices are 69 and 62 respectively (national median = 100). Rent is comparable in both cities, with less than $50/month separating them.

Median household income is $18,093/year higher in Amarillo. Home values also differ significantly — the median in Amarillo is $186,800 compared to $138,600 in Birmingham.

Texas has no state income tax, giving Amarillo residents a significant tax advantage over Alabama's 5.0% rate.
